Introduction to Professional Networking

🤝 Network Power: Professional networking in Bitcoin estate planning creates collaborative relationships that enhance service quality, expand expertise, and build sustainable practice growth through shared knowledge and referrals.

Professional networking in Bitcoin estate planning extends beyond traditional legal networking to encompass technology experts, financial professionals, and specialized service providers. The interdisciplinary nature of Bitcoin inheritance planning requires collaborative relationships that bridge legal, technical, and financial expertise.

Networking Importance in Bitcoin Estate Planning

Unique Networking Requirements:Technical Expertise: Access to qualified technology experts and specialized service providers • Regulatory Knowledge: Connections with professionals experienced in digital asset regulations • Cross-Disciplinary Collaboration: Relationships spanning legal, financial, and technology sectors • Emerging Field Dynamics: Networks that provide access to cutting-edge knowledge and developments • Professional Support: Peer relationships for consultation and collaboration on complex cases

🏛️ Industry Association Participation

Primary Professional Organizations

Essential Association Memberships:American College of Trust and Estate Counsel (ACTEC): Premier estate planning professional organization • American Bar Association (ABA): Section of Real Property, Trust and Estate Law • State Bar Associations: Estate planning sections and digital asset committees • International Association of Estate Planning Professionals: Global estate planning network • Cryptocurrency and Digital Asset Professional Organizations: Specialized industry associations
